I am curious to know if there is anything in the package, specifically in the CEEMDAN class that addresses the end effects issues with EMD?

Can you please elaborate what do you mean by "end effects issue with EMD?" EMD supports mirroring for time series beginning/end and CEEMDAN uses these algorithms when computing EMD. Is there anything else needed?
